What is Qodo?
Qodo (formerly Codium) is a quality-first AI coding platform designed to empower developers by streamlining the process of writing, testing, and reviewing code. It leverages the power of generative AI to offer features like automated code reviews, contextual suggestions, and comprehensive test generation, ensuring robust and reliable software development.
Features of Qodo
- Code Generation: Qodo's AI algorithms can generate code snippets in various programming languages, saving developers time and effort.
- Automated Code Reviews: The platform analyzes code for potential issues, vulnerabilities, and adherence to best practices, providing valuable insights for improvement.
- Contextual Suggestions: Qodo understands the context of your code and offers relevant suggestions for completions, refactoring, and bug fixes.
- Comprehensive Test Generation: Generate a wide range of tests, including edge cases and scenarios, to ensure code reliability and catch potential problems early on.
- Seamless IDE Integration: Qodo integrates with popular IDEs like Visual Studio Code and JetBrains, providing a streamlined development experience.
- Git Integration: Leverage Qodo's capabilities within your Git workflow to enhance code reviews and collaboration.
How to Use Qodo
Qodo offers a free VSCode extension and JetBrains plugin, allowing developers to start using its AI-powered features immediately.
Pricing
Qodo provides a free tier for individual developers.
Frequently Asked Questions
Why don't I just ask ChatGPT to write my tests? How is Qodo different?
While ChatGPT can generate code, Qodo specializes in code integrity. It focuses on generating tests that thoroughly cover your code's functionality, identify edge cases, and improve overall robustness. Qodo's approach involves sophisticated prompting techniques, context analysis, and test generation strategies tailored specifically for testing.
When will I be able to start using Qodo Products? Are they free?
You can start using Qodo products today! The VSCode extension and JetBrains plugin are available for free.
What languages are supported?
Qodo supports a wide range of programming languages, ensuring compatibility with diverse development projects.
How does Qodo make sure my code stays secure?
Qodo prioritizes security, privacy, and compliance. It only analyzes the necessary code for test generation, encrypts data using SSL, and holds SOC2 certification.
Does Qodo write perfect tests?
AI technology is constantly evolving, but perfection is elusive. While Qodo can significantly enhance your testing process, it's essential to review and validate the generated tests to ensure accuracy and completeness.
I want to join you guys!
We welcome talented individuals to our team! Please send your resume to [email protected].